Comfort and Fit

For me, comfort is one of the biggest factors when buying winter boots. The Ugg Adirondack III Waterproof Boot feels supportive and warm, but I also pay attention to the fit. In my experience, winter boots should not feel too tight because I may want to wear thicker socks. I always check whether I should size up, especially if I plan to use them in very cold weather.

What I Check Before Buying

Before I buy, I usually check:

  • My correct size and whether I need room for thick socks
  • The climate I will use it in
  • Whether I need extra ankle support
  • How much walking I will do
  • The return policy, in case the fit is not right

These details matter to me because winter boots should feel practical, not just look good.
